What Are In-App Purchases and How Do They Affect Free Apps?

When you're browsing the app store, you may have noticed the message “In-app purchases” next to the “Get” button for free apps or the app price button for paid apps. This message indicates that users will have the opportunity to pay for additional features, content, or services within an application. In-app purchases are a way for developers to offer their apps for free while still making a profit. In-app purchases refer to the purchase of goods and services from an application on a mobile device, such as a smartphone or tablet.

They can take the form of an e-book, the ability to play without seeing ads, and more. Users don't make any payments during the download and installation process. After the trial period, depending on the applications, they pay an annual or monthly subscription or make a one-time payment. In-app purchases are mandatory when you charge for something used in the app, such as a subscription, an e-book, a game update, or exclusive content for premium members.

If you're selling physical products, such as t-shirts, you don't need to use in-app purchases. Apple has changed the way it used to label free apps so that users can easily identify if an app is free or not. If you're looking for an app in the iOS or Mac stores, you'll see that even if people download an app for free, it's likely that it could cost them something through in-app purchases.
